There’s no doubt that the U.S. economy is being battered by downturns in housing and the financial markets. Economist Jeffrey Carr says Vermont’s economy is also struggling; business leaders say the strength of the Canadian dollar has helped to draw many Quebec shoppers to Vermont; Senator Bernie Sanders is sponsoring a bill that would overturn the Environmental Protection Agency’s decision about tailpipe emissions from cars.
